    Zip extraction from windows 11 by windows
    D

    Basically I used powerarchiver context menus to zip up a folder then i used windows 11 own built in zip extractor via the context menu to extract all and this is where it throw up a fault. , I’m using windows 11 .

    The file that was a problem in the zip that windows 11 could not extract was iva “babe” cotton.jpg
    I know it has non standard quotes in it.

    However I had winrar on the computer and tried the exact same method with their context menu compress to zip and then I extracted the file with windows own extract all context menu and it had no problems. This indicates that powerarchiver is doing something different with iva “babe” cotton.jpg compressing to zip.

    Then I changed iva “babe” cotton.jpg to iva babe cotton.jpg and compressed it with powerarchiver and then tried it with windows 11 extract all and had no problems. It looks like powerarchiver is doing something to that one file that has quotes in it.

    Please note that powerarchiver extracted both zip files with no problems, only windows built in zip extraction had the fault. Reason I’m letting people know in case they send zip files with special characters in files names to people who do not have powerarchiver.

      using PA11.02.03 (11/2008), with this version (and previous ones), opening an archive including filenames with German “Umlauts”, these do not display correctly:
      i. E. a filename “dänermark.mdb” displays as “dõnemark.mdb”
      This does not happen, if the file was compressed using PA. These files were compressed using a backup software. But, extracting this very archive using filzip
      or tugzip displays “in listing after opening” and extracts this filename correctly!
      I attached an archive showing that behaviour, the file was created using tugzip, watchout for the filename after extracting using PA!

                ok, here is the problem - archive is created by software that uses non standardized zip unicode support.

                Currently PA would not support it even if it had proper unicode support since current engine supports only ANSI zip archives.

                Reason those 2 other softwares support it is probably they use the same zip engine so it works for them :-).

                I tried opening it with every major compression software we have installed - WZ, WR, 7z, SecureZip and none of them support it either.

                Good news is that we will add this support relativly soon :P

                1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                • spwolfS
                  spwolf conexware
                  last edited by

                  Additionally, way to solve the issue would to force software to save as ANSI… from my knowledge, I can guess what zip engine they use and the way to do it would be to set non-unicode support to German, in Regional and Language settings> Advanced options.

                  This will force that zip engine to save as ANSI and it will then work in every archiver out there. I hope that helps.
